Forget Deflation, China Is Set To Rebound Strongly On Easing And Stimulus

July 09, 2012   |   July 2012 Bond Updates
China’s slowdown is more dramatic than previously thought, inflation data revealed on Monday.  But, despite CPI falling to a 29-month low, and economists like Nouriel Roubini expecting a hard landing in the near term, there are signs that China will rebound in the second half of the year, Nomura’s global economics team says.
